Visa has announced its plan to acquire Featurespace, a UK-based cybersecurity and analytics software firm. This acquisition aligns with Visa’s commitment to strengthening its portfolio of fraud detection and risk-scoring solutions, providing clients around the world with innovative tools to combat financial fraud.

Visa Inc. (NYSE: V) is the world’s leader in digital payments. Our mission is to connect the world through the most innovative, reliable and secure payment network – enabling individuals, businesses and economies to thrive. Our advanced global processing network, VisaNet, provides secure and reliable payments around the world, and is capable of handling more than 65,000 transaction messages a second. The company’s relentless focus on innovation is a catalyst for the rapid growth of digital commerce on any device for everyone, everywhere. As the world moves from analog to digital, Visa is applying our brand, products, people, network and scale to reshape the future of commerce.
